Output c5f16cd1697a43dc210c4b8fb981202942f6367a40d0bca26db362d67eec00b6:5

value
1374523720
script pubkey
OP_0 OP_PUSHBYTES_32 42e0628eda91bc4b579671036c17c6db08970b0b48df5aec9f97e88485e311e2
address
bc1qgtsx9rk6jx7yk4ukwypkc97xmvyfwzctfr044myljl5gfp0rz83q0qkv4r
transaction
c5f16cd1697a43dc210c4b8fb981202942f6367a40d0bca26db362d67eec00b6
spent
true